Acquaint Your Child With the Dental Office



Beginning by taking your child to the oral workplace before their initial go to, so they can come to be aware of the environments and really feel more secure. This step is essential in helping to decrease any type of anxiousness or fear your child may have concerning going to the dentist.

Right here are a couple of methods to familiarize your kid with the oral workplace:

- ** Set up a fast tour **: Call the dental workplace and ask if you can bring your youngster for a short trip. This will permit them to see the waiting area, treatment areas, and satisfy the pleasant staff.

- ** Role-play in your home **: Act to be the dental practitioner and have your kid sit in a chair while you analyze their teeth. This will help them understand what to expect throughout their actual browse through.

- ** Review books or see video clips **: Look for kids's publications or video clips that clarify what happens at the dental professional. This can aid your kid feel more comfy and prepared.

Furnish Your Child With Healthy Oral Habits



Establishing healthy and balanced dental behaviors is essential for your kid's oral wellness and general health. By teaching your kid good oral practices from a very early age, you can help prevent dental cavity, gum condition, and other oral health and wellness concerns.

Beginning by instructing them the value of brushing their teeth twice a day, utilizing a soft-bristled tooth brush and fluoride toothpaste. Show them the appropriate brushing method, seeing to it they clean all surfaces of their teeth and gum tissues.

Urge them to floss daily to remove plaque and food fragments from in between their teeth.

Restriction their consumption of sugary snacks and drinks, as these can add to tooth decay.

Finally, schedule normal dental exams for your kid to keep their oral health and resolve any problems early on.
